    I am a newbie too, and I actually started my internet business a few days ago. However, I am already receiving subscriptions and sales. I went for tons of workshop and I can finally categorize non- SEO traffic to these five types.

    1. Article marketing : By writing articles related to your keywords, it adds your ranking and creates many backlinks and clicks to your web, besides branding you. Just submit articles to Ezine articles( use it a lot), and start building traffic. Oh yeah, you can also get others to write for you if you are not one for writing. Something like freelancers.com should work for you well ! Post as many articles as you can as fast as you can to get better results.

    2. Video marketing : Make and post videos on youtube with your link! Make it funny or interesting and soon viewers will be flocking your site. As long as the content you give them is good, youtubers generally will see it. You can also make videos of you reading out the articles you have written and posted, it might be boring but at least it has good info!

    3. Blogging : Frankly, I am still trying it out and it is not really working for me, but other bloggers say that it is working for them. Just post a blog every day or two and try to put in good content in it. It seems you can also write it in a diary sorta style, as long as it is interesting! Use wordpress.

    4. Solo Ads : Paid traffic that does not guarantee subscribers. It is a great way to start out when your list is low, but start out slow. Test the waters first. See how many clicks or subscribers you are getting with them and reevaluate the worth of the solo ads. Generally, if you can get a certain amount of subscriptions or sales then, it is worth investing on. Really the trial and error system for internet marketing.

    5. Classified Ads : UsFreeAds is the classified ads strategy I am using right now. There are actually more targeted people to your niche by marketing it with classified ads. And besides it ranks fine on Alexa, the traffic ranking is 1k++ which is considered not bad. You might wanna try it out too !
